  • SX700 has a loud zoom in/out, which got picked up by the video. Is it normal?

    Hi All,
    I just received my Canon SX700 and went out for a test today. The picture quality wes good, the video image quality was great as well. I heard zooming in and out sound when I was shooting the video using SX700. After I came home and play it on my computer, the zooming in/out sound is indeed loud and clear. In addition, I heard clicking sound in some zooming in and out as well. Is it normal? Is it an one off defect? Should I return it? And comment/ suggestion/ advice is appreciated!
    Best regards,
    Sally

    The noise you can here is the zoom motor stopping and starting and very little you can do about it. The internal microphone is only doing it's job... picking ALL the sound up it detects.
    These cameras in the video mode is only a gimmick, the quality of these internal microphones leaves a lot to be desired, the only way round it is to use an external microphone, whether these cameras have that facility I can't say, do consult your user manual on using an external mic.
